Construction for New Eastham Library To Begin This Month

libraryEASTHAM – Eastham residents will have a new library late next year, according to Eastham Library Director Debra Dejunker Barry.

The process to construct a new library began with a grant that the previous library director wrote several years ago.

She said Nauset Construction of Needham will build the $9 million facility which is expected to open in either December 2015 or January 2016.

The library board of trustees were awarded a construction grant from the Massachusetts Board of Library Commissioners for $4.3 million and the town matched the grant with $4.5 million.

Until then, Barry said they will have a temporary home in three trailers by the end of the month.

The modular trailers are being set up on Eastham Town Hall property. While those trailers are being set up, the library will continue with its regular hours on Samoset Road.

A groundbreaking ceremony for the new library is scheduled for Saturday, September 13 from 11 AM to 1 PM.
